Cullen College of Engineering Dean Joseph Tedesco is stepping down from his post on Oct. 31 to serve as Special Assistant to the Provost.

All of us at UH appreciate his hard work in helping build the college into one of the region’s premier engineering schools. During his time at the helm, the college has earned recognition by U.S. News and World Report for its graduate programs. Under Dean Tedesco's leadership, the college significantly contributed to the tripling of research expenditures at UH since 2008 by garnering major grants, including national centers and the most recent U.S. Department of Defense contract of $63.5 million. Most recently, he played a critical role in the Division of Technology’s merger with the Cullen College.

We are grateful for Dr. Tedesco’s contributions to both the Cullen College of Engineering and UH. He is an exceptional scholar in the discipline of civil engineering and will continue to support student success and academic excellence at the University.

Pradeep Sharma, chair of the department of mechanical engineering, will serve as interim dean as we begin a national search for the next leader of the Cullen College of Engineering.

I’d like to thank Dr. Tedesco for his exceptional service to the college and its students and offer my gratitude to Dr. Sharma for accepting the role of interim dean.

Updates on the search process, including committee members and selection of an executive firm, will be available soon.
